Output 58c40dd267e4d5d60357e6f90ed14a48b0a692bce4dc7b252ad240cc7c997a37:1

value
6402512
script pubkey
OP_0 OP_PUSHBYTES_20 12a3234070bbdc32209edb134e937e9c85221595
address
ltc1qz23jxsrsh0wrygy7mvf5aym7njzjy9v4zd5zjc
transaction
58c40dd267e4d5d60357e6f90ed14a48b0a692bce4dc7b252ad240cc7c997a37
spent
true